  1. May I pledge or use my Welkom Yizani shares as a form of security?

    Participants are not and will not be entitled to enter into any agreement in terms of which their Welkom Yizani ordinary shares are used as security or encumbered in any other manner.

  2. My [relative] has died and has a Welkom Yizani share certificate. What must I do?

    Your [relative's] estate will be permitted to transfer your [relative's] shares to an eligible Black Person having at least a similar or higher BEE status/rating than your [relative], in terms of the articles

  3. I need money and wish to sell my shares.

    Welkom Yizani shares may not be traded during the minimum investment period

  4. When can I trade in Welkom Yizani shares?

    The shares cannot be traded during the minimum investment period which ends 8 December 2013. After that time, you should be able to trade your shares on an over the counter market

  7. I have become insolvent and my estate is being sequestrated. I need to sell my Welkom Yizani shares?

    Then your estate will be permitted to transfer your shares to an eligible Black Person having at least a similar or higher BEE status/rating than yourself, in terms of the articles. You should ask your Liquidator to contact Link market Services

  8. My marital status has changed. How does this impact on my Welkom Yizani shares?

    Please provide us with a certified copy of your marriage certificate so that we can register the shares in your new name.
